As the longest-established training programme for Bowen in the UK and Europe, Bowen Training UK offers a unique opportunity to learn from the original pioneers of the Bowen Technique (Bowtech).
Under the auspices of the Bowen Therapy Academy of Australia, since 1993 we have trained more practitioners in the original Bowen Technique than any other college. We are proud that Bowtech is now seen as a benchmark for similar programmes.
Our Bowtech therapists form part of an international network of Academy-registered practitioners influencing health care in over 30 countries around the world. Only Bowtech gives access to the full range of procedures documented directly from founder Tom Bowen (1916 – 1982), who developed this unique therapy in his clinic in Victoria, Australia.
Since then, his work has been continued by Ossie and Elaine Rentsch (pictured left) ensuring more and more people can benefit from this gentle yet dynamic therapy which has been shown to have a profound effect on the body.
Bowen Training UK is the only college to have extensive support throughout the world with over 120 accredited teachers. Only Bowtech gives access to the full range of procedures documented by Oswald Rentsch directly from Tom Bowen himself.
No previous experience is needed to start learning the Bowen Technique which comprises seven basic modules. Our team of instructors, who have completed their own accredited intensive training programme, provides advice and support throughout.

CPD Bowen Body Decoding Workshop July 2024
Georgi ilchev returns to the UK after a well-attended and successful Part 1 workshop in 2023, to present Bowen Body Decoding Part 2 for those who attended last year. In addition, due to demand, he is offering Part 1 and Part 2 together on July 24th -25th, and July 26th -27th. The venue for all dates is Horley, Surrey. Born from a desire for simplicity, how to assess each client for a successful Bowen Therapy outcome, Georgi’s focus is upon a thorough consultation with physiotherapy assessments.
He tailors the assessment for each individual client in a precise and ordered way by using observation, palpation, checking and re-checking any imbalance and performance of muscles, and postural alignments.
Georgi presents his innovative course with theory, explanations, demonstrations and lots of hands-on practical. His presentation is like a revision of Module 8, with more detail and examples.
In the workshop, therapists work together in practice led by Georgi, learning both what it is like to be a therapist carrying out assessments and a client being observed and performing tests. There is plenty of practical, with a manual available for your laptop or tablet to follow along in the workshop, as well as on a large screen.
Georgi runs his own school and private practice and is president of the Bowen Association of Bulgaria. He is author of seven books to do with physiotherapy, muscle testing, kinesiology and Bowen Technique.
This CPD course offers 16 hours for each part (8 hours each day).

The Mind Body connection and Bowen Technique is a powerful combination when listening to the body. Allows the client to be in a safe comfortable space using Mind Body Bowen (MBB) techniques to respond and release stress areas, bringing about relaxation and calmness to often long-term conditions.
Bowen moves are carried out carefully and with precise timing to help unlock tension areas built up in the body. These may arise from memories or the subconscious and may have been deeply buried or masked over the years. Specialised session/s such as MBB are helpful when a client is not getting better or needs to ‘tune in’ to the sensations felt in the body which are clues to where restriction or blockages are residing. The Bowen practitioner will be guided throughout the training in this 2-day workshop, that, by using mindfulness aspects and the ‘felt’ or interoceptive sense, Bowen can have a role in the release of post trauma stress including the enduring effects of Birth, prenatal and post birth issues. “Every body is better with Bowen” - whether for physical, emotional or mental presentations. As we clear residual tensions the person can become more embodied and present, connected to their ‘authentic self’ - all confirmation of the truly wholistic nature of this amazing modality.
Traditional medicine and energy concepts such as the Chinese meridians, chakras and the energy field surrounding the body will be observed and their links to muscles groups and Bowen Therapy procedures will be explored.
Travelling over from Australia two very experienced Bowen Therapists and Teachers Margaret Spicer and Vianne MacBeth will present the course. Margaret Spicer last visited the UK in 2013 and this course was well received. Many members will remember the profound experience of learning the tools for MBB and may wish to return. Newer members open to the knowledge that health exists on various levels of mental, emotional, spiritual, physical, and more will be curious to learn how to help their clients. This workshop material is suitable for all Bowen practitioners, indeed many wish they had done this type of workshop early in their practice as it can give great insight into what is happening for their clients.
